OUR FARM

After serving in the U.S. Air Force Joseph and Kimberley Friesenhahn returned to Kim's home state along with their children to live a simple life in rural Vermont. In 2017 we purchased a small 30+ acre property and set out to restore the once-thriving sheep pasture into a regenerative silvopature for our livestock.
 
We don't mind getting our hands dirty growing our food so, we jumped at the opportunity to raise our food and share it with the community. 
We have a passion for knowing where our food comes from and learning the art behind caring for our animals which, results in premium products such as raw milk and hand-crafted milk soap for our customers.
​
Located in the Upper Valley area of Vermont, our farmstead is nestled near the base of Mount Ascutney, in Windsor, Vermont.

We are a tier-1, raw milk producer licensed in Vermont. All our licensing, compliance and animal disease testing paperwork is available for public review in our shop.
